My 2020 RST Z71 came with 18” wheels and 265-65-18 tires, if I go up to 20” wheels do I stay with the same size tire with no issues? I’m not wanting to lift or level. The only reason I’m even thinking about it is there is a set of RST style wheels that caught my eye but they come in 20”. If I’m going to cause unwanted issues I will keep on looking. Thanks guys!

275/55R20 would be the same diameter as 265/65R18.

 

OE 20's is 275/60R20 as others mentioned which is a 33" tire.

You won't notice any ride difference from an 18" to a 20" on the T1.  The 20" tire has a 1.5" larger O.D. (33") compared to 30.5" on the 265/65/18.  Going to a 2" larger 20" wheel only gives a 1" difference in the sidewall height so comparing both has no ride difference because the sidewall height is almost the same.  Rode in too many of these trucks to know.  The 18"s to me just don't look good.  First thing I did with my RST was remove the 18's.
